Output d1c68a8074cd7527696f7e4eacf4e50fb9738919e011b097abeb61603f941880:1

value
345639280
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e12d76783351d967f14f9be73bdfb06f4f83fa59e2265927c0235797104f71b0
address
tb1puykhv7pn28vk0u20n0nnhhasda8c87jeugn9jf7qydtewyz0wxcqxmwx2v
transaction
d1c68a8074cd7527696f7e4eacf4e50fb9738919e011b097abeb61603f941880